On August 10, Won Min-seok, a researcher at Hi Investment & Securities, stated, "Recently, the company's stock price has shown a continuous upward trend reflecting the value of the copper foil business based on the expansion prospects of the xEV industry. Steady capacity expansions are planned going forward, so a solid trend is expected to continue. The 4th plant, which began mass production in March 2020, will contribute significantly to earnings starting from 3Q20. Additionally, the 5th and 6th plants, each with a capacity of 9,000 tpa, are planned to start mass production in 1Q22 and 3Q22, respectively. These are expected to contribute to future earnings improvements." He set the target price for SKC at 105,000 KRW.
